Calgary firm joins Oracle Modernization Alliance

Calgary firm joins Oracle Modernization Alliance

By:  Briony Smith  On: 11 Sep 2007 For: ComputerWorld Canada Creator

CipherSoft unites with the database giant and a number of other vendors to focus on "open systems" that will preserve the business content of their existing applications

Other companies have started similar alliances in the past. In 2004, for example, Microsoft began the Mainframe Migration Alliance, with the goal of providing the information and tools to aid IT organizations seeking to migrate applications from the mainframe to the Windows platform. Here, too, the association’s goals were to offer lower costs to their clients and enhanced flexibility, courtesy of newer technology (although, in Microsoft’s case, organizations would be switching to a proprietary system, rather than open technology like a pure Java set-up).
